José Aguilar (boxer)

José Aguilar Pulsar (19 December 1959 4 April 2014) was a Cuban boxer. He won the Light Welterweight bronze medal at the 1980 Summer Olympics.

He died in Guantánamo on 4 April 2014 from a cerebral infarction.[1]

1980 Olympic results

  • Round of 32: Defeated Martin Brerton (Ireland) by TKO 1
  • Round of 16: Defeated Ryu Bun-Hwa (North Korea) by decision, 4-1
  • Quarterfinal: Defeated Farouk Jawad (Iraq) by TKO 3
  • Semifinal: Lost to Serik Konakbayev (USSR) by decision, 1-4 (was awarded bronze medal)
